The albumimage directive is supplied by the album plugin.

Each viewer page produced by the album directive contains an albumimage directive, which is replaced by an img, wrapped in some formatting using a template (by default it's albumviewer.tmpl). That template can also include links to the next and previous photos, in addition to those provided by the trail plugin.

The next/previous links are themselves implemented by evaluating a template, either albumnext.tmpl or albumprev.tmpl by default.

The directive can also have parameters:

  • title, date, updated, author, authorurl, copyright, license and description are short-cuts for the corresponding meta directives

  • caption sets a caption which is displayed near this image in the album and viewer pages

The viewer page can also contain any text and markup before or after the albumimage directive, which will appear before or after the image in the viewer page.
